Cango (CANG) recently released its official the previous quarter earnings results, per public filings made available earlier this month. The reported adjusted ear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ter came in at -11.623, while no formal revenue figures were disclosed as part of the initial earnings release package. The results landed amid broader market uncertainty surrounding automotive commerce and financing platforms, which have faced shifting consumer demand patterns and tighter credit condit

Management Commentary

During the accompanying earnings call, Cango leadership centered discussions on the firm’s ongoing operational restructuring efforts, which have been rolled out across its core automotive transaction facilitation and financing service segments in recent months. Management noted that persistent macroeconomic headwinds weighing on consumer light vehicle purchase sentiment have put significant pressure on the firm’s bottom line over the the previous quarter period, though they emphasized that targeted cost-reduction measures implemented throughout the quarter have already started to reduce recurring operating expenses. No specific segment-level performance breakdowns were provided during the call, with leadership citing ongoing strategic reviews of non-core business lines that may be scaled back or divested as part of the firm’s long-term profitability roadmap. Leadership also highlighted investments made in digital customer acquisition tools over the quarter that could potentially lower user acquisition costs in upcoming periods. Forward Guidance

Cango (CANG) did not issue formal quantitative forward guidance alongside its the previous quarter earnings release, a decision that aligns with prior public statements from the firm citing high levels of market volatility as a barrier to providing reliable numerical forecasts. Management did offer qualitative context for upcoming operational priorities, noting that one-time restructuring costs would likely continue to weigh on near-term financial performance, but that the firm remains focused on preserving sufficient cash reserves to support its highest-margin core business lines through the current market cycle. Analysts following the name have noted that the lack of formal guidance may contribute to elevated share price volatility in upcoming trading sessions, as market participants adjust their financial models to reflect the latest reported results and strategic updates. Market Reaction

Following the release of the the previous quarter earnings results, CANG shares traded with above-average volume in after-hours sessions, with price action reflecting mixed investor sentiment. Some market participants expressed concern over the wider-than-expected per-share loss and the lack of disclosed revenue figures, while others pointed to the firm’s aggressive restructuring plans as a potential catalyst for improved operational efficiency over the long term. Equity analysts covering Cango have begun updating their coverage models following the release, with many noting that they plan to follow up with the firm’s investor relations team to gain additional clarity on top-line performance trends for the quarter. Broader performance for peer firms in the automotive fintech and commerce space has been mixed in recent weeks, a trend that could also influence near-term trading dynamics for CANG shares.
